If you're diving into the exciting world of 3D printing, you want a solid printer that won't break the bank. Here are some great budget-friendly options that are perfect for beginners. These picks provide a nice balance between price and performance, so you can start creating without any stress.
The Creality Ender 3 is a fan favorite. It's got a sturdy build, a large build volume, and an active online community. You'll find tons of tips and tricks if you ever run into issues. Plus, it’s super easy to upgrade as you get more comfortable with 3D printing. What’s not to love?
Another solid choice is the Anycubic i3 Mega. This one comes mostly assembled, which is a huge win for beginners. It heats up quickly and produces impressive prints right out of the box. You'll appreciate how user-friendly the touchscreen is, too. It’s all about making your first prints as smooth as possible.
Don’t overlook the Monoprice Select Mini V2. This compact printer fits just about anywhere, making it perfect for small spaces. It comes fully calibrated and ready to go, so you won’t be fiddling too much before you make your first print. It’s stress-free and gets the job done!

Mid-Range Models with Great Features
Looking for a mid-range 3D printer that doesn’t skimp on features? You’re in luck! These models offer a solid mix of quality, reliability, and versatility without breaking the bank. Whether you're a hobbyist or a small business owner, you'll find something that fits your needs.
One of the standout options is the Prusa Mini. This printer is compact, making it perfect for small spaces. It’s user-friendly and comes semi-assembled, so you won’t spend hours piecing it together. It also has a great print quality and an active community for support, which is a big plus.
Another fantastic choice is the Anycubic Vyper. It's got auto bed leveling, which takes a lot of guesswork out of the setup process. Plus, it has a larger build volume, allowing you to create bigger projects. Users rave about its easy operation and reliability—perfect for those just getting started with 3D printing.
If you want a printer that offers dual extruders, check out the Artillery Sidewinder X1. It’s great for multi-material projects, giving you the ability to use different filament types in a single print. The build is solid, and the touch screen interface is super intuitive.

High-End Options for Serious Makers
If you're a serious maker looking to dive into the world of 3D printing, high-end options are where it’s at. These printers pack powerful features, delivering the precision and reliability that dedicated creators crave. They might come with a higher price tag, but believe me, they’re worth it if you want top-notch results.
One standout in the high-end category is the Prusa i3 MK3S+. It’s known for its robust build quality and impressive performance. The setup is straightforward, and it offers a ton of community support. You can print with different materials, including PLA, PETG, and even flexible filaments. With features like power recovery and a magnetic bed for easy print removal, this printer is a game changer for any serious maker.
Another fantastic option is the Ultimaker S3. It’s designed for professionals wanting to push their limits. This printer offers excellent print quality, a wide range of compatible materials, and a big build volume. Plus, the dual extrusion feature lets you print complex designs with ease. If you're working on prototypes or detailed models, this is a reliable choice that won’t let you down.

Best Versatile Printers for All Projects
When you're diving into 3D printing, you want a printer that'll handle everything you throw at it. The best versatile printers can tackle different materials and project types without breaking a sweat. Here are some top picks that fit the bill.
The Creality Ender 3 is a favorite among hobbyists. It's affordable and has a solid build, making it great for beginners and experienced users alike. You can print in various filaments, like PLA, ABS, and PETG. Plus, it has a large community online, so you'll find plenty of support and upgrades to keep things exciting.
Looking for something a bit smarter? The Prusa i3 MK3S+ is a highly-rated option that gets tons of praise in 3D Printer Reviews. It features automatic bed leveling and sensors to prevent failures midway through a print. It's great for those who want reliability and quality. You can experiment with different materials without worrying too much about the setup.
If you’re interested in resin printing, the Anycubic Photon Mono is a fantastic choice. This printer delivers amazing detail, making it perfect for miniatures or intricate designs. It's user-friendly and has a decent build volume for its size, plus it's pretty affordable for a resin printer. You'll be amazed at what you can create!
